First and Last Time
Unquestionably, the worst course I've ever set for on. Compacted dirt fairways make your ball bounce as if you were playing on concrete. You should probably golf with whiffle balls. There's no roll out, only bouncing off the dead, weed covered desert fairways. I was down a sleeve through 4 holes. I left after 5. I could see someone being a member due to the very nice pool and bar. You cannot say enough about the staff. They were great. They have an iced cooler full of bottled water, which was nice, but there really needed to be water on the course. They should consider using ATVs instead of golf carts. What cart path there is, is like driving through the Rocky Mountains. If you've got a bad back, it's not for you. Even in spots where there is cart path, you really are better off driving beside it.
Terrible conditions.
Nothing but nice things to say about the staff that work here, but the course is in awful shape to the point where it’s just fun to laugh at it. Cart paths drives like your mountain climbing, the ‘fairways’ are just dried out dirt-so if you hit a shot you can count on atleast 30-40 yards of rollout PAST THE GREEN. Most of the tee boxes are just dried out dirt so good luck actually teeing the ball up. Again I will say the staff is great and so polite. Greens fees costing 23$ still felt like a ripoff considering the fairways are predominantly dirt.
Fairways are hard and rough, cart paths are terrible, greens were soft and in decent shape. For $22 a good 18 hole course.

Great clubhouse & staff, poor course conditions, 7-some!!'
Have played here many times, but probably not again for a while. Course is in rough shape. Awesome clubhouse and inside staff, but they allowed a group of 7 guys to play together. Pace was good after the 7-some randomly quit after hole 10.
Fairways aren't in great shape, most cart paths are mud, greens not like they used to be.
Bellevue Course
A lot of maintenance is being performed on the course, but there is still a ways to go. Greens are in decent shape but extremely fast. Tee boxes are being improved, but could really use some watering. You basically need a hammer to get the tee into the ground. Fairways are in fair condition but remain very rough/bouncy. So far, better than last year, and I think it will continue to improve based on new management efforts!
Very disappointing
Through 18 holes, the course overall has alot to be desired. Tight hard fairways with spotty grass. Rough the is entirely unplayable around most areas. Water leaks throughout the course. And greens so hard that balls dropped in from 50 yds, fail to stay on the massive expanse of slick shirt grass. At the full greens fee rate? I would consider this a major fail.
Otherwise the staff and clubhouse amenities are top notch. Probably THE best part of the experience.
